大数据驱动下的PHP高效架构实践
|
在当前大数据快速发展的背景下,PHP后端工程师需要不断优化架构设计,以应对高并发、海量数据处理等挑战。传统的单体架构已难以满足业务增长的需求,因此采用更高效的架构模式成为必然选择。 引入缓存机制是提升系统性能的关键一步。通过使用Redis或Memcached,可以有效减少数据库压力,提高响应速度。同时,合理设置缓存策略,如TTL和缓存穿透防护,能够进一步增强系统的稳定性。 在数据存储方面,采用分库分表策略有助于提升查询效率。结合读写分离和主从复制,可以实现数据的高效管理和负载均衡。利用消息队列如Kafka或RabbitMQ,能够解耦系统模块,提升整体吞吐能力。
AI生成的趋势图,仅供参考 代码层面的优化同样不可忽视。通过减少不必要的数据库查询、优化SQL语句、使用预编译语句等方式,可以显著降低系统延迟。同时,遵循PSR规范编写代码,有助于提升可维护性和团队协作效率。 监控与日志分析是保障系统稳定运行的重要手段。借助Prometheus、Grafana等工具,可以实时监控系统状态;而ELK(Elasticsearch、Logstash、Kibana)则能帮助我们快速定位问题,为后续优化提供数据支持。 持续集成与自动化部署也是提升开发效率的重要环节。通过CI/CD流程,可以确保代码质量,加快上线速度。同时,结合容器化技术如Docker和Kubernetes,能够实现更灵活的资源调度和弹性扩展。 在实际工作中,我们需要不断学习新技术,关注行业趋势,并结合业务场景进行架构调整。只有这样,才能在大数据驱动下,构建出高效、稳定的PHP后端系统。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

